There is no any built-in support for network gaming in NHL95PC. So IPX support in Dosbox won't be enough. That means somebody must built that support to game or some kind of program which makes multiplayer gaming via network possible with Dosbox and NHL95PC. I suppose programming gurus can do almost anything if they put their mind and time for it, but as far as I know, nobody is working to solve this "problem" ;)

There is many VNC-software solutions available, which may work. Although I have not heard that anyone has managed to make this kind of combination (Dosbox/DOS + DOS game without network game support) work as multiplayer gaming via VNC.
